I experience a strange issue with the object inspector in the toolset. It is hard to explain so I provided a video. When I try to open a menu [...] for anything (ex. Base Skin Texture) nothing pops up like it used to but it seems to disable the ability to select anything else in the program unless I release it from this invisible barrier using the Esc key. Any idea of how I could fix this issue?

WOOT!!!!! There it is!!!! Changed which monitor was primary and it magically appeared right in the middle of the newly secondary screen! Hmm...that's a bit of a wtf, isn't it? I'd changed which monitor was primary to get swtor running on a marginally better graphics card and that must have created the problem.
